3rd Week Post-Op Update

Today I weighed-in at 266.0 pounds. That is a 0.4 pound gain from last week. Although it would have been great to have had a loss this week, I have followed my doctor's orders and have resisted temptation all week. The temptation I have had this week is kind of strange. I haven't been tempted to eat junk food or comfort food, etc. What has been tempting is pushing the limits of my soft/mushies phase of the diet from my doctor (in regard to the consistency of the food). I wish I had some more specific ideas on what to eat at this stage. Alot of the ideas I have found are either high in carbs or foods that I just don't like. I have been eating small amounts of chicken salad, sugar free fat free pudding and jello, V-8 juice, and yogurt. I have still been drinking protein shakes at least once a day. I have also been drinking lots of crystal light. I ordered this book today, Eating Well After Weight Loss Surgery: Over 140 Delicious Low-Fat High-Protein Recipes to Enjoy in the Weeks, Months and Years After Surgery. I had gotten it from the library several months ago and it looked like exactly what I need. I have been exercising alot this week too. I have been walking and going to strength training classes. I feel great and people are starting to notice the weight loss.
